Melkamu Benjamin Daniel Frauendorf (born 12 January 2004) is a footballer who plays as a midfielder for Premier League club Liverpool. Born in Ethiopia, he is a youth international for Germany.

Club career[edit]

Frauendorf joined Liverpool in 2020, after previously playing for 1899 Hoffenheim, where he scored 7 goals in 40 games for the U17 team.[4]

He made his competitive first-team debut in an FA Cup third round match against Shrewsbury Town on 9 January 2022.[5]

On 9 November 2022, he started his first game for Liverpool in the win against Derby County in the third round of the EFL Cup at Anfield.[6]

International career[edit]

Frauendorf is eligible to play for Ethiopia and Germany, and has been capped at various youth international levels for the latter.[4]

Personal life[edit]

Frauendorf's brother, Melesse, is also a footballer, who came through the academy at Hoffenheim with Melkamu and who now plays for TuS Mechtersheim.[7]
